Hull Earthquake Activity: Analyzing Recent Reports
In recent weeks, Hull has seen a marked increase in seismic activity that has sparked both concern and intrigue among residents and specialists alike. The British Geological Survey documented several minor quakes with magnitudes between 2.0 and 3.2 on the Richter scale. Although classified as minor incidents, they serve as a reminder of the tectonic forces operating beneath this region’s surface. Key observations include:
- Magnitude Differences: The recorded tremors vary in strength but have not resulted in any significant damage or injuries.
- Rising Frequency: There is an observable increase in occurrences with multiple quakes happening within short intervals.
- Local Experiences: Many residents reported sensations similar to heavy vehicles passing nearby during these tremors.
The surge in seismic activity is currently under investigation by seismologists who suggest that previously dormant geological fault lines may be reawakening due to shifting tectonic plates beneath them.
